On October 2nd, 3rd and 4th, ATH – Drama and Arts Space presents a new production of the play The Exception and the Rule, written by Bertolt Brecht and directed by Quentin Delorme. The play takes place at 8pm on October 2nd and 3rd, and at 07 pm on October 4th.
Written in 1929 – 1930, The Exception and the Rule is a short Lehrstück (learning-play) focusing on the theme of social justice. On a journey across the Jahi Desert, the four main characters represent different social classes. Tragedy unfolds when class differences manifest, and justice becomes a farce.
Directed by French director Quentin Delorme, The Exception and the Rule combines drama and improvisation theatre. Actors are both themselves and characters on stage. The audience will perhaps wonder constantly whether they are watching a play, an improvisation show or a chaotic rehearsal.
The play also challenges the actors and the director’s creativity and flexibility, since the audience is invited to change some elements of the stage and the actors’ performance. This idea of audience participation makes each show different from the others. This is also how Quentin Delorme and his troupe choose to build Brecht’s epic theatre.

Director
A graduate of the internationally-renowned drama school Cours Florent in France, Quentin Delorme began his creative work in theater at a young age and won the Paris Young Talent Prize when he was 24. He has worked as a stage director in France, Morocco, Italy, and Vietnam. His theatre, as a part of a contemporary movement and a perpetual research, centers on the rules of theatre. Trained in drama and improvisation, he is inspired to mix these two disciplines in his works.
